Following on from LEGO The Lord of the Rings LEGO The Hobbit is inspired by the first two films in the Hobbit Trilogy and it’s out in Australia on April 16
No matter your gaming weapon of choice the team at LEGO have you covered. LEGO The Hobbit will be available on PS3, PS4, PS Vita, Xbox 360, Xbox One, Wii U, Nintendo 3DS, and PC. If you don’t have one of those then you’re not likely to be reading about a computer game now are you!
In this game you’re playing along with your favourite scenes from the films as the game follows the Hobbit Bilbo Baggins as he is recruited by Gandalf.
You can explore all the middle-earth locations from the film, participate in treasure quests, mining for gems or even build some new LEGO structures.
If you’ve got an Xbox or Playstation console the game also has a fantastic “drop-in, drop-out” gameplay option so you can play along with friends and family and not have to start from the beginning or end the game when one person leaves.
For kids, that’s going to be a hit.
